A healthcare provider is "qualified" under the Act when the provider or their insurance company pays cash to a state fund. If the healthcare provider is "qualified," the amount a hurt individual can recuperate is most likely topped, regardless of how severe the individual is harmed. There is likewise an unique law of limitations on the moment duration whereby an individual may bring a claim versus a "certified" doctor. Since nowadays, a lot of doctor get qualified status, this short article will concentrate on the statute of constraints applicable to qualified healthcare providers.

One such exception is illegal cover-up, which applies when the specialist actively hides their negligence or misrepresents truths. to avoid the injured party from discovering the wrongdoing. In such instances, the law of restrictions does not start up until the fraud or cover-up is revealed. Also the most skilled medical professionals make errors with drug names and signs. From describing obsolete terminology to wrongly analyzing icons, a medical professional can mistakenly recognize a drug, which can place a person in major difficulty. This type of wrong medication instance often causes an unfavorable response in individuals that can not endure specific components.
